  • 4x4 trip @ Bunyip State Park. Dec 2017
    Tracks were in reasonable condition with Andersons still being slippery and a little bit of mud and bog holes still around.
    The long wheel base of the Ranger proved to be its Achilles Heel on the muddy hill climb but after 3 attempts managed to slide over with a bit more momentum.
    The Defender with its great articulation did all the tracks with ease but was not present at the time of the rock crawl section.
    Tracks driven on the day include:
    Andersons TK
    Bunyip Ridge TK
    Western TK
    Gentle Annie TK
    Bullock Link TK
    There are 4 vehicles in this video however one disappears for a little while to help a fellow 4x4 found travelling solo with mechanical issues get back to civilization safely.
